エントリーの編集
エ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
記事へのコメント0件
- 注目コメント
- 新着コメント
このエントリーにコメントしてみましょう。
注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ています
- バナー広告なし
- ミュート機能あり
- ダークモード搭載
関連記事
RPPL - Qiita
RPPLとは、Read Parse Print Loopの頭字語である。(今考えた。) 次を~/.pryrcに追記する。1 $__is_pry_r... RPPLとは、Read Parse Print Loopの頭字語である。(今考えた。) 次を~/.pryrcに追記する。1 $__is_pry_rubyvm_ast_mode = false def ast! $__is_pry_rubyvm_ast_mode = !$__is_pry_rubyvm_ast_mode end Pry.config.hooks.add_hook(:before_eval, :"RPPL") do |code, _pry| next if code == "ast!\n" next unless $__is_pry_rubyvm_ast_mode x = code.inspect code.clear code << "RubyVM::AbstractSyntaxTree.parse(#{x})" end